1

我正在做一个小项目,以更熟悉如何设置和运行 Node 项目。我想用 ES6 编写它并通过 NPM 脚本运行它,所以我安装了以下库:

"@babel/cli": "7.2.3",
"@babel/core": "7.3.3",
"@babel/node": "7.2.2",
"@babel/preset-env": "7.3.1"

在我的项目的根目录中,我有一个 index.js 入口点,并在我的 package.json 中创建了以下脚本:但是,"order": "babel-node index" 当我npm run order在控制台中执行此操作时,我收到以下错误:

internal/modules/cjs/loader.js:583
    throw err;
    ^
Error: Cannot find module './src/read-file'

我的 index.js 中的第一行是:import { readFile } from './src/read-file';
这是我的 .babelrc:

{
    "presets": ["@babel/preset-env"]
}

我缺少什么使它起作用?

4

0 回答 0